Output 894104ec7f3637d8b31fa988fe142d467ff50b9c15c6a37a96913a16c97eb7ae:0

value
180436
script pubkey
OP_0 OP_PUSHBYTES_20 bf3577c988cede8a68b3432ffabc3b5d35896daa
address
bc1qhu6h0jvgem0g569ngvhl40pmt56cjmd2jxf0tp
transaction
894104ec7f3637d8b31fa988fe142d467ff50b9c15c6a37a96913a16c97eb7ae
spent
true